I think the debate for "unplugging" the hot water tank during the day is 
much light the argument for lowering the house temp during the day and at 
night.  There are a whole lot of variables.  If the hot water tank is 
sufficiently insulated, not having it run during the day won't make a damn 
bit of difference.  If it is very poorly insulated, chances are you would 
save money by not reheating the same water over and over.

The reality is that it is somewhere in between, probably closer to 
sufficiently insulated than not.  So, I am guessing it makes very little 
difference.

Your neighbor should just put a timer on it rather than going through the 
effort of turning it on and off by hand, assuming it is electric that is.
